Old Dogs Need Love Too!
Pet care experience
4 years ago I adopted a 12 year old beagle, Arya, who had been at the shelter for several months. Due to her age she and some disfigurement done to her ears by her previous owner, she was mostly ignored by the potential families seeking to adopt. After spending some time with her, I knew I had to adopt her. It was always tough knowing that with her advanced age, she would not be with us long, but I wanted to make sure her remaining years were great, and I believe they were. Sadly, Arya pasted away a year ago due to old age. While I am not ready to adopt again just yet, I would be honored to care for your beloved pet (young or old). I work at home and can easily drop-in to give your dog a few belly rubs (or any other interaction he/she prefers) at anytime.
